Safety

Bunk beds are an excellent option for children to make space, but if they are not assembled and maintained in a safe manner they could pose a safety risk. Make sure that your bunk bed is fitted with a sturdy ladder, guard rails, and a mattress foundation for the age and height of your children. Instruct your children to be careful when climbing up and down the top bunk, and to avoid rough play which could weaken or damage the structure.

Children under six are most likely to be injured by bunk beds. This is due to the fact that they lack coordination and have no ability to sleep safely on the top bunk while climbing down the ladder. Because of this, bunk beds should only be used by children older than the age of 6 and no child younger than the age of six should sleep on the top bunk.

If your kids are going to sleep on the top bunk, be sure that there are full length guard rails that extend at least 5 inches higher than the mattress's surface. You should also check whether there are no gaps or holes on the guardrails for the upper bunk. This includes the ladder and mattress foundation. Your children's bodies, limbs, or heads could easily pass through. Check for any dangers by inserting a wedge block into the gaps or openings and then pulling on it gradually and with a steady force.

Make sure your children do not hang their clothes, toys or other items from the top bunk or ladder area. These items can cause tripping hazards, which can result in strangulation or falls. Make sure your children remove any tripping hazards before bedtime. Encourage your children to do the same thing for guests when they are having an overnight stay.

Don't let your children jump or roughhouse the ladder or bunks. This can cause them to fall or even become trapped under the bunk. Also, ensure that only one child is using the top bunk at any one time, as jumping or rough playing can cause the mattress foundation to collapse and even cause the child to be crushed.

Stability

A bunk bed is a unit that has two beds placed one on top of the other. It's an excellent way to maximize space in a bedroom that is small. Bunk beds are available in various styles to suit any decor. They are available in metal and wood and can be customized to look as traditional or modern as you like. Some models even have storage underneath the bunk. This is a great way to keep clothes as well as toys and other items well-organized.

A high-quality double bunk bed must have strong sturdy guard rails, strong and sturdy, as well as an appropriate ladder that can handle the weight of children as well as adults. The ladder must have solid frame and slip-resistant steps. It should be at a minimum of fifteen inches (based on US regulations) above the mattress's surface to keep children from getting caught in themselves.

The mattress slats shouldn't be more than 4 inches apart. This will prevent limbs from getting stuck between the slats or falling through them, which could cause serious injury. Bunk beds should be properly assembled according to the manufacturer's specifications and regularly scheduled maintenance and inspections must be performed.

In addition to these safety measures in addition, you must teach your children to use the bunk bed in a safe manner. For example you should not let them jump on the top bunk and only one child should be sleeping there at the same time. It is also important to remind your children not to use the top bunk as a playground and to refrain from climbing or hanging on the framework.

A twin over full bunk bed is a great choice for siblings who are close in age, and some models even have the possibility of adding a third full-size mattress under the lower bunk. This is a great solution for families who frequently host guests or accommodate children who aren't at home.

Style

A bunk bed is a great option to make use of shared space in the bedroom of the child. They are not only comfortable and fun, but they also save the floor space which can be used for other purposes. When shopping for bunk beds, think about the design and features that are important to you and your children. The most important feature is safety. Make sure that the bunk bed is strong and that the ladder or stairs are safe. It is also essential to keep the area surrounding the bunk bed clear of clutter. This will prevent injuries and accidents.

Bunk beds are available in a variety of designs and sizes. They can be made to adapt to any space. The most popular type is the twin over twin, which consists of two twin size mattresses that are placed one on one over the other. This type of bunk bed is great for smaller spaces because it maximizes space and makes an ideal place to sleep with friends. There are also models with additional features, such as desks, drawers, and storage underneath the beds. This is great for kids bunk bed mattresses who share the same room.

Another popular kind of bunk bed is the loft bed. These beds are generally bigger than standard bunk beds because they do not connect. Some loft beds come with a standard ladder, whereas others come with an escalator. This makes it easier for children to climb and descend. Some loft beds can be divided into two beds, based on the model. This is an ideal option for families who plan to move in the near future.

If you're looking for a unique style, think about an L-shaped bunk bed. This kind of bunk bed is designed in the shape of an "L" and is perfect for small spaces because it can be used to save space. It is also simple to assemble and comes with the standard ladder that can be upgraded to an additional staircase if needed.

Another type of bunk bed that works for smaller space is a triple bunk bed. These beds are three separate beds that are attached to a single frame. These beds are ideal for children with lots of friends who spend a lot of time sleeping. These bunk beds are constructed to be secure and kids Bedroom furniture include features such as metal or wooden guard rails for the top bunk and a trundle beneath the bottom bunk for sleepovers.
